Agreed with the post above. It was part of my initial plan when i started this thread, to let members know which TD can source accurate models and cases. However i now believe (despite what certain members or TD claims), TDs do not get to choose their watches. They get their watches from the same source and when certain batch runs out, a TD that gives u good cases might be given old cases from the main source/factory. For example, i asked nearly every TD to source for a 390 noob from the previous batch and none could find one. Most TDs couldn't care less about what case you get (an example above whr TD claims its a new case but fact is its the old crap). My advice is, to pickup this hobby you need to learn. Alot.

How do you tell it's the new case when it has the tall bezel?

Based on lugs and lugholes placement, overall finish quality and very well defined (probably even more than gen) edges. I am not really PAM expert but I believe that tall bezel is actually en attribute of new cases as it's caused by too well defined (not rounded as noob or gen) transition edge between lower vertical and sloped surface of the bezel. Maybe there are already different batches of new cases/bezels. Some taller with sharper edge and some bit lower with slightly more rounded edge.

Worth to note that even the latest hfac cases have different batches. The one i received have a slightly thinner bezel. From my survey the 000,111,112 etc comes with random cases. Boutique models have better case and usually more consistent. Don't take my word for as it is based from my observation on various qcs.
